Synthesis, antimicrobial properties of novel mannich bases containing 2- phenoxy-1, 3, 2-benzodioxa phosphole and Indole systems

Author(s): P. Jagadeeswara Rao, K. S. Bhavani Aishwarya, D. Ishrath Begum and L. K. Ravindranath

New novel mannich bases of 2-phenoxy-1,3,2-benzodioxaphosphole derivatives 2 - (4-substituted phenoxy) - N’-[2- oxo-1, 2-dihydro-1-(piperidine-1-ylmethyl) / (morpholino methyl) / (4 - methyl piperazine - 1 – yl methyl) indole – 3 - ylidene] - 1, 3, 2 -benzodioxaphosphole-4-carbohydrazide-2-oxide 6(a-g) were prepared by the condensation reaction between 2-(4-substituted phenoxy)-1,3,2-benzodioxaphosphole-4-carbohydrazide-2-oxides (3) with Isatin (4) yielded the corresponding 2-(4-substitutedphenoxy)-N’-(-2-oxo-1,2-dihydro-3H-indol-3-ylidene)-1,3,2- benzodioxa- phosphole -4-carbohydrazide-2-oxide (5). This was allowed to undergo the Mannich reaction with different Secondary Amines namely: piperidine, morpholine and N-methyl piperazine in the presence of formaldehyde in DMF to give corresponding hydrazides 6(a-g). The chemical structures of these newly synthesized compounds were characterized by 1H-NMR, Mass, IR, C13-NMR and P31-NMR Spectral data. These newly synthesized compounds 6(a-g) were screened for their antibacterial and antifungal activity.
